Transformative Care in Intensive Care Unit

At City of Hope, we're dedicated to delivering exceptional patient care in our Intensive Care Unit. As a critical care registered nurse, you'll play a vital role in providing compassionate and expert care to our patients.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Direct patient care through the nursing process, collaborating with patients, families, and healthcare professionals.
  • Provide leadership to non-licensed staff, setting an example of excellence and promoting a culture of safety.
  • Communicate effectively with physicians and other healthcare professionals, ensuring seamless care coordination.
  • Assess patient needs through a holistic approach, adjusting treatment plans as needed.
  • Document interventions and supervise care delivery by unlicensed support staff.
Patient and Family Education:

As a critical care nurse, you'll provide patient and family education regarding disease processes, treatment side effects, and health promotion. You'll document education and support provided according to department standards.

Compliance and Quality Improvement:

You'll ensure compliance with hospital policies and accrediting agencies, participating in the development, review, and updating of policies and procedures. Actively engage in the Performance Improvement plan of the unit to enhance patient care quality.

Medication Management:

Obtain patient medical history and medication information, documenting appropriately in the patient's medical record. This role requires strong communication skills, clinical expertise, and a commitment to quality improvement to ensure safe and effective patient care.

We're seeking a dedicated and compassionate critical care registered nurse with 1-3 years of experience in a bedside care setting. Oncology experience is preferred, as is recent ICU and/or step-down experience.
